Lights A and B are the LED (Light Emitting Diode) type. Consult your SUBARU dealer for replacement.

Bulbs may become very hot while illuminated. Before replacing bulbs, turn off the lights and wait until the bulbs cool down. Otherwise, there is the risk of sustaining a burn injury.

Replace any bulb only with a new bulb of the specified wattage. Using a bulb of different wattage could result in a fire.
